The Nightlife Scene in Austin

Austin, also known as the Live Music Capital of the World, is renowned for its vibrant nightlife, especially when the University of Texas is in session[4]. There’s no shortage of places to go and things to do in Austin when the sun sets.

Sixth Street: The Heart of Austin’s Nightlife

One of the most popular areas for nightlife in Austin is Sixth Street, where you’ll find a plethora of bars and clubs to choose from[1]. 

Some of the most popular bars and clubs in Austin include the White Horse, the Rose Room, and Antone’s Nightclub[1]. These venues cater to various tastes and preferences, so whether you’re into live music, dancing, or just enjoying a drink with friends, there’s something for everyone in Austin.

Live Music Capital of the World

As the Live Music Capital of the World, Austin boasts a thriving music scene with plenty of live music venues and festivals throughout the year. 

Some of the city’s most iconic music events include Austin City Limits and South by Southwest (SXSW). No matter when you visit, you’re likely to find a live show to enjoy.

The Nightlife Scene in Houston

Houston, the fourth-largest city in the United States, has a diverse nightlife scene that caters to various tastes and preferences. From upscale lounges to laid-back dive bars, Houston has something for everyone[1].

Diverse Nightlife Options

Houston is known for its diverse nightlife options, offering something for everyone[10].

You can find a wide range of bars, clubs, and live music venues throughout the city, catering to different music genres and atmospheres. Whether you prefer a relaxed night out or a lively party scene, Houston has got you covered.

Austin vs Houston: Which is Better for Nightlife?

Deciding whether Austin or Houston has a better nightlife scene ultimately depends on your personal preferences. Here are some factors to consider when making your decision:

Budget

In terms of affordability, Houston is generally cheaper than Austin for budget travelers[3]. This means that if you’re looking to save some money while enjoying a night out, Houston might be a better choice.

Atmosphere

Austin’s nightlife is centered around live music and a vibrant college scene, making it a great choice for those who love music and a lively atmosphere[4]. 

On the other hand, Houston offers a more diverse range of nightlife options, from upscale lounges to laid-back dive bars[10]. If you’re looking for a more varied experience, Houston may be the better option.

Live Music Scene

As the Live Music Capital of the World, Austin is the clear winner for those who prioritize live music in their nightlife experience. 

With numerous live music venues and iconic music festivals like Austin City Limits and South by Southwest, Austin is a music lover’s dream destination.
